emhttp crashing on first access by browser

Featured Replies

I've recently (since, but not immediately following, upgrade to 5.0 final) been getting emhttp crashes:

 

emhttp: emhttp_read_line: emhttp_read_line: input line too long

 

I have tried disabling plugins, no help.

 

Interestingly, if I issue a wget 127.0.0.1 from a console login I get the index.html page back just fine. So it seems to be related to accessing it from the browser. Maybe the request or the headers or the cookies are causing a problem?

 

Is there any way to get more info, or a core file, or something from the crashing process?

 

Also, any way to restart emhttp other than a manual array stop and reboot?
